Abstract
This paper presents advanced audio zip (AAZ), an audio codec that provides the fine granular bit-rate scalability from lossy to lossless coding. Perceptually embedded coding principle is employed in AAZ to provide lossy reconstruction with optimal perceptual quality at intermediate bit-rates. AAZ also provides the backward compatibility where the lossless bit-stream embeds a compliant MPEG-4 AAC bit-stream.
